Another day, another milestone for WB’s Joker. The DC Films flick zoomed past Deadpool ($783 million) and Deadpool 2 ($785 million, but with $50 million from the PG-13 Once Upon a Deadpool cut) on Thursday to become the biggest R-rated movie ever in unadjusted global grosses. It earned $5.46 million on Friday (-36%) to bring its 22-day domestic cume to $264.144 million. That puts it, sans inflation, above the $259 million cume of Captain America: The Winter Soldier and the $262 million cume of The Amazing Spider-Man. There’s $30 million between Amazing Spider-Man and Man of Steel ($291 million), so Joker is sticking around in 18th place among comic book movies for awhile.
